Thirst Mutilator posted:

These are both helpful and annoying (not your fault obviously). I did jump into the discord to see if there was any other guidance but it was also lacking beyond later base challenges though, so I'll take what I can get.
I did it all with pre-nerf bases and a lot of unbound research, so a fair chunk of this is likely out of date, but here's a brain dump of what I remember:

-gatling laser is the most busted thing right now, so use that because the damage formulae don't care about the base weapon type
-you can't really grind core computing over time because the salvage gain is linear. use v1 weapons until you can get v2 to 95 or higher (the only important damage factor is the damage upgrades from the weapons themselves) and if you hit a wall that's it, you're screwed, go do something else. this one wants regular laser on your non-gatlings for the synergy upgrade if that gets the 10x, I do not recall if it does, check that yourself sorry :shobon:
-power hungry is impossible to grind further than your natural cap because you don't get more reactor capacity over time, either you get there or you don't
-my strat for synth purity 4 works for the previous three as well, because it was "take a nap". (by accident. forgot it was running.) don't ignore the lower tier materials altogether, you can bank up like 1e10 white alloy and then 1e9 green and so on up the chain and end up with a chunk more multiplier. this one actually scales pretty well for the first few hours if you just need a little more push to get one or two sectors further.
-for base, you want to have some of the "allows boosters" pinks in 3, then as many boosters as possible pointing to "multipliers" in 3 and 2, then four boosters pointing to damage in 1 and glass-cannon it. note that the way the multiplier tile scales, you only want to have them if they have the same number of boosters around them - if you have one touching 3 and one touching 2, the latter is actually weakening your total multiplier - so if you don't have the middle of base 3 you end up with 6x3 boosted in base 2 and 3x3 boosted in base 3.

KazigluBey posted:

Can anyone post the recommended layouts for the base challenge in USI?
assuming you do not have MIDDLE BAR of base 3 (but assuming you do have the rest, there'll be a note below).
I took these outside the challenge so uh, ignore all my numbers lol accidental humblebrag
general principle: boosters are still insane because compounding multiplication, so you're going to have very few tiles doing the heavy lifting for everything else
the way the yellow "increase multiplier" tiles work is that there's a dividing factor based on the number of them around, so you want to be sure every one of them is as boosted as they can be (and you don't have any others that are being less boosted, because then you get like, one worth 20x less but it still divides the total by 1.25 more so you end up behind)

base 1 is for damage, also shield around the edges because you might as well:

you can replace the 3x boosted greens with reds for a small additional damage mult, but it's drowned out by the 4xs anyway

base 2 is for multiplier:

the reds are just filler, they can be greens, but I like damage. the important thing here is that you can't get a 4x boosted anything, so 3x boosted is cap, so fill every 3x boosted slot with multipliers

base 3 is for booster-permitting and multiplier:

the middle row is not reds, it's just blank, because I assumed nobody had it if they didn't get it pre-nerf. if you have it, you actually want to 4x boost the two yellows and then the bottom yellow can be a red.
the goal here is to contribute some 3x boosted multiplier and then the rest is being allowed to use boosters, because they're the broken thing
if your pink isn't strong enough to allow this build (not sure if pink goes up with upgrades) or you're missing some of these squares as well, add pinks where you can (for instance, drop the two rightmost tiles on the two bottom rows for pinks if needed)
